Skip to content

CodeQL

CodeQL #561

Triggered via schedule March 1, 2024 16:04
Status Success
Total duration 4m 29s
Artifacts

codeql-analysis.yml

on: schedule
Matrix: Analyze
Fit to window
Zoom out
Zoom in

Annotations

20 warnings
Analyze (csharp): ImperatorToCK3/Imperator/Characters/PortraitData.cs#L91
TODO verify if still require for Invictus version higher than the original pre-hotfix 1.7 (https://github.com/meziantou/Meziantou.Analyzer/blob/main/docs/Rules/MA0026.md)
Analyze (csharp): ImperatorToCK3/Imperator/Diplomacy/Dependency.cs#L12
TODO use Imperator subject type definitions to determine how the subject should be treated in CK3 (contracts and obligations) (https://github.com/meziantou/Meziantou.Analyzer/blob/main/docs/Rules/MA0026.md)
Analyze (csharp): Fronter.NET/Fronter.NET/Services/SentryHelper.cs#L26
This async method lacks 'await' operators and will run synchronously. Consider using the 'await' operator to await non-blocking API calls, or 'await Task.Run(...)' to do CPU-bound work on a background thread.
Analyze (csharp): Fronter.NET/Fronter.NET/Extensions/TranslationSource.cs#L152
Use an overload that has a IEqualityComparer<string> or IComparer<string> parameter (https://github.com/meziantou/Meziantou.Analyzer/blob/main/docs/Rules/MA0002.md)
Analyze (csharp): Fronter.NET/Fronter.NET/Extensions/TranslationSource.cs#L153
Use an overload that has a IEqualityComparer<string> or IComparer<string> parameter (https://github.com/meziantou/Meziantou.Analyzer/blob/main/docs/Rules/MA0002.md)